Community Activity
Community and official content for all games and software on Steam.  
Popular Hubs
Team Fortress 2
239 new artwork this week
NieR Replicant ver.1.22474487139...
853 new screenshots this week
People Playground
36 new artwork this week
Detroit: Become Human
3 new artwork this week